Tinubu To Dissolve Management And Board Of MDAs, Plans To Remove Buhari’s Political Appointees
President Bola Ahmed Tinubu has reportedly ordered the dissolution of all management and boards of Federal Ministries Agencies, and Parastatals.
New Telegraph gathered that President Tinubu directed the Office of the Secretary to the Government of the Federation (OSGF), to dissolve the Management and Board.
Multiple sources privy to the development said the shake-up will affect all political appointments made by the outgone President Muhammadu Buhari’s administration.

“A formal announcement is imminent. It will happen in days, not even a week. It will be made public any moment from now.
“The highest ranking civil servant will temporarily supervise the various agencies, pending the announcement of a new Management and Board”, one of the sources said anonymously.”
It added that the dissolution and replacement of the management and boards will allow President Tinubu, who assumed office on May 29, 2023, to make his own appointments and further consolidate his grip on power.
